What is the difference between Theorem Proving vs Formal Verification Engineer?
| Aspect | Theorem Proving | Formal Verification Engineer |
|---|---|---|
| Required Credentials | Mathematics, Computer Science degrees, certifications in theorem proving tools | Computer Science, Electrical Engineering degrees, certifications in formal methods |
| Work Environment | Research labs, academia, industry R&D teams | Hardware/software companies, tech firms, industry R&D teams |
| Industry Usage | Mathematical proof development, academic research, complex system validation | Hardware design, software verification, safety-critical systems |
While both roles involve formal methods, Theorem Proving focuses on developing mathematical proofs for systems, often in academic or research settings. Formal Verification Engineers apply formal methods to verify hardware and software correctness in industry, ensuring system reliability and safety.
